A day in the life of a Murphy Senior Engineering Manager: Lead the engineering design delivery of existing major Transmission HV 132/275/400kV Substation new build and extension projects. Lead Design Management requirements at tender and/or Early Contractor Engagement stage and allocate resources as appropriate during tender, FEED, and detailed design stages. Integrate multiple engineering disciplines including HV Plant, Protection and Control and Civils from a mix of internal and external designers and OEMs. Undertake the role of Principal Design Representative on project(s) ensuring design information is being suitable managed to the various roles and compliant with the requirements of CDM 2015 Regulations Involvement in the development of Business Unit and Group Design Management continual process improvement activities Review design pack submissions as required for technical compliance, quality and completeness. Develop and assist the project Planners with maintaining the design and engineering aspect of programmes. Monitor and expedite key engineering programme issues including the procurement of services and equipment to the Business Unit Procurement function. Review and liaise with internal Temporary Works Coordinators and Designers to ensure appropriate consideration of constructability and required permanent works. Ensure an understanding of, and an influence on the contracts Design Consultants are working under including their fees, schedule of services, programme, and liabilities and warranties. Review and comment the payment applications from consultants and pass to the contract surveyor for processing and payment. Still interested, does this sound like you? Experience managing multi-disciplinary design packages on HV Power Projects. Electrical engineering education (preferably to degree level) and High Voltage project design experience Experience carrying out the role of Principal Designer Representative under CDM 2015 Experience of delivery of substation projects for UK Transmission Service Operators (SSEN, National Grid, Scottish Power Energy Networks, NIE Networks) is desirable. Membership of a UK Engineering institute

Overall responsibility for all engineering activities related to Extra High Voltage (EHV) cable systems (400kV, 275kV, 132kV AC) across design, procurement, installation, testing, commissioning and rectification works. Lead the technical delivery and assurance of HV cable projects, ensuring compliance with customer scope, specifications, processes and relevant IEC/British Standards. A day in the life of a Murphy Engineering Manager ( HV Cables) Review the design of EHV cable systems, with a focus on 400kV, 275kV, and 132kV AC and DC systems with the ability offer practical installation, testing and maintenance inputs Practical experience and appreciation of civil engineering aspects of HV cable installation including the management of temporary works and trenchless crossing design and installation techniques. Possess a robust understanding and application of cable system design principles, including thermal ratings Provide technical support to the Procurement function through scope production, review of designer specifications, BoMs and review of offers/proposals for the purchasing of HV cables and associated accessories, engaging with international suppliers. Lead supplier engagement for Type Testing, customer Type Registration requirements and Factory Acceptance Testing (FAT), ensuring all deliverables meet associated IEC, British Standards and customer specifications/scope. Ensure all engineering activities and deliverables are fully compliant with applicable standards and client specifications. Oversee and support HV cable installation, jointing, and termination (AIS/GIS) works, ensuring best practice and high standard of safety are considered at all times. Provide technical leadership for site teams, including the review and acceptance of supplier and subcontractor Risk Assessment Method Statements (RAMS), Inspection Test Plans (ITPs), checklists, and associated QA/QC documentation. Manage and coordinate HV testing and commissioning activities, including pressure testing, sheath testing and system energisation. Lead technical investigations into asset failures, conduct root cause analysis, and report findings. Develop and implement corrective and preventive actions to mitigate future risks through NCR and Lesson Leartn processes. Build and lead a high-performing HV Cable Engineering team, fostering a culture of technical excellence and continuous improvement. Mentor and develop junior engineers, supporting their professional growth Promote knowledge sharing and best practice across the team and wider business. Support RDEC claim for projects and area of expertise Represent the business in technical meetings, audits, and reviews with National Grid and other key clients. Champion best practice in health, safety, and environmental management, working closely with the SHES department. Ensure all engineering activities are conducted in accordance with company policies and legal requirements. Still interested does this sound like you? Degree in Electrical/Power Engineering or equivalent. Chartered Engineer status (or working towards) with IET or IMechE. Significant experience (typically 10+ years) in EHV/HV cable system design, installation, and commissioning. Demonstrable experience with technical procurement and supplier management for HV cable systems. In-depth knowledge of IEC, British Standards, and National Grid Technical Specifications. Proven track record in leading technical investigations and implementing corrective actions. Experience in developing and leading engineering teams. Ideally with xperience with CYMCAP or similar cable rating software and maybe experience in both onshore and offshore HV cable projects. Familiarity with digital engineering and GIS for cable projects would be a bonus
